Frozen Pina Colada (in a bucket)

Mix all of the ingredients in a large bucket (like an empty ice cream pail) and freeze. Easy peasy!

Ingredients

  • 48 ounces pineapple juice or tropical juice
  • 1 can coconut cream 13-15 ounces
  • 12 ounces coconut rum
  • 4 ounces dark rum
  • 10 ounces frozen lime-aid concentrate 1 can
  • club soda or Lemon-Lime Soda, optional

Instructions

  1. Combine all ingredients in a large ice cream pail or another bucket.
  2. Freeze overnight, stirring after about 4 hours.
  3. Remove from freezer 15 minutes before serving.
  4. Run a lime around the edge of a glass and dip in sugar if desired.
  5. Fill glass with frozen Pina Colada mix & enjoy or fill glass half full of Pina Colada Mix and top with soda or lemon-lime soda.

Notes

  • For a fun twist (or for a virgin pina colada), leave out the rum and scoop frozen pina colada mix halfway into a glass adding club soda or lemon-lime soda.
  • Because the alcohol keeps it from freezing solid, the non-alcoholic version takes a little bit more to scrape out so freeze in a shallower dish (such as a 9x13 pan). You may need to leave it to sit out a bit longer than 15 minutes before scraping.
